To convert drops (gtt) to teaspoons (tsp), it's important to know that there are typically about 60 drops in 1 teaspoon. Therefore, to find out how many teaspoons make 180 drops, divide 180 by 60. This means 180 gtt is equivalent to 3 tsp.

180 cc is equivalent to 180 milliliters (ml), as the two units measure the same volume. The conversion is straightforward, with 1 cc being equal to 1 ml. Therefore, 180 cc and 180 ml represent the same amount of liquid.
